1: Come to White River State Park on the first Tuesday of each month during the summer for Community Tuesdays! Discount admissions to each of our world-class attractions!
Community Tuesday Attractions at WRSP (Tweet @WhiteRiverStPrk):
Eiteljorg Museum (Tweet @EiteljorgMuseum) – Adults $4.00, Seniors $4.00, and children are free
IMAX Theater (Tweet @imaxINDY) – $2.00 off the ticket price
Indiana State Museum (Tweet @IndianaMuseum) – Standard admission tickets are half-price (half-price discount does not include admission to special exhibitions)
Indianapolis Indians Baseball at Victory Field (Tweet @IndyIndians) – When the Indians are home, you receive $2.00 off tickets by either: 1) showing your membership to another attraction or 2) showing that same day’s ticket stub from one of the other attractions
Indianapolis Zoo & White River Gardens (Tweet @IndianapolisZoo) – All tickets are $8.00
NCAA Hall of Champions (Tweet @NCAA #HallChampion) – $1.00 off tickets
2: Plan your visit to the Indianapolis Zoo when hours are extended for the summer concert series! Animals & All That Jazz and Zoolapalooza concerts are sure to bring fun for the whole family, with the exhibits and splash park open late for more hours of fun! Animals and All That Jazz and Zoolapalooza are free for Zoo members and included with regular Zoo admission. Visit the Indianapolis Zoo on Facebook for a coupon worth $4 off admission after 4pm for Zoolapalooza concerts. Plus, save $2 for up to four guests when you bring a Dean’s milk carton to be recycled on the day of the Animals & All That Jazz concert! 3: Come to the NCAA Hall of Champions on Tuesdays at 11 a.m. for a FREE reading from a former NCAA Student-Athlete! Story Time with a Former NCAA Student-Athlete is a family friendly activity open to the public; and remember: if you come on Community Tuesday, you can bring the whole family to experience the interactive sports equipment in the rest of the museum for a discounted rate!
4: Keep track of FREE days for the Eiteljorg Museum and the Indiana State Museum. On Martin Luther King Jr. Day, both attractions open their doors to the public. For free admission, just bring a canned food donation. For Independence Day 2012, the Eiteljorg was free to celebrate the holiday.

7: Just a picnic and enjoy any of our gorgeous green spaces at White River State Park. From the canal walk to the White River Promenade to our lovely art sculptures and the 92 County Walk outside the Indiana State Museum, White River State Park offers many breathtaking views of Indianapolis that are sure to take your breath away.
